Why Choose an EV?
The rise of electric vehicles is fueled by their positive environmental impact.
Why EVs are gaining popularity:
- Lower operating costs
- Helps fight climate change
- Less noise and vibration
- Government incentives and tax credits
For eco-conscious and cost-aware drivers, electric vehicles are an increasingly forward-thinking choice.
Limitations to Consider
Understanding the limitations of electric vehicles will help you make an informed decision.
EV challenges to consider:
- Shorter range compared to gas vehicles
- Charging infrastructure gaps
- Though often offset by long-term savings
- Batteries degrade over time
As technology advances and infrastructure improves, many of these challenges are becoming less significant.
